Optimize Limited Space with Multi-Functional Design
Maximize your basement theater by using foldable seating, retractable screens, and wall-mounted storage. Mirrors and light shelves reflect ambient lighting, creating depth. Choose compact audio receivers and display units that blend seamlessly into the room’s architecture, ensuring every inch serves a purpose.
Smart Audio and Visual Setup on a Budget
Prioritize quality sound with affordable surround systems like compact 5.1 speakers or a single high-fidelity center channel. Pair with a slim-profile projector or wall-mounted LED TV for clean lines. Use acoustic foam panels and heavy curtains to minimize echo, enhancing clarity without major renovations.
Lighting Control for Immersive Atmosphere
Layered lighting sets the mood—install dimmable LED strips along walls, a touch-sensitive ceiling fixture, and floor lamps for ambient glow. Smart bulbs connect via apps, letting you adjust color and intensity for movies, games, or lounging, transforming the space effortlessly.
